With another 100,000 doses of the AstraZeneca vaccine arriving in the country yesterday, Australia has so far provided 560,000 doses to Fiji.

Australian High Commissioner to Fiji, John Feakes they will continue to work together to reach their target of providing 1 million doses to Fiji.

71.5% of the target population have now received the first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ine while 14.7% of the population are now fully vaccinated.

This means that 419,673 people have received the first dose in the country while 86,505 people have received both doses.

Fiji’s target population for vaccination is 586,651 adults.
